The organization of our Stallite, Sparta, dates from the time of Thelen Khron. This came after construction of the Temple to the Sun God and the Great Square.

The Sunseers, initiated by the light of wisdom and messengers from the Sun God, welcomed into their newly-built city all of the Just who sought refuge there.

The Guardians of Fire, loyal servants of the Sun God, helped the Sunseers welcome, lodge, and protect the new arrivals.

The structures, from the finest to the most humble, were erected by the Builders. It was the famous Turkhan who planned the most resplendent of Sparta's spaces.

Men and women skilled in farming and hunting joined together to form the Providers.

And the many Scavengers -- old and young, men and women -- helped everyone make Sparta a haven of peace and light amid the Darkness...

As we're getting ready to climb the stars, our attention is caught by some kind of container.

sc00940.jpg



Here we can fill our empty flasks with Stohll. This liquid seems to increase our regenerating rate. (Did I mention that our Slayer form has regenerating abilities ? :D)

sc00944.jpg



Now that he have all the booze we can carry, let's move on. First stop will be Master Oiler's place.

What's this ?

sc00947.jpg

sc00948.jpg



(Spitrod = Boomstick). This is some kind of gun component. On the self we also find a lead plaque. This can be used to make bullets, as we'll see later.

sc00951.jpg



Let's head upstairs. BTW, Have you noticed those two black meters next to our health meter ? That is our Black Rot meter. It increases as time passes.
